Chapter 43: Catching the Mole
“Father, what I mean is that the Third Prince refuses to let the Ling and Luo families off the hook. Ziqi was already hostile toward my little sister, and now that the two of them have joined forces, I’m afraid they’ll pose an even greater threat to both our families,” Ling Jiaxuan analyzed.
“You’re right, Xuan’er. But for now, we must first catch the person who poisoned someone in the Prime Minister’s Residence. Since they were able to put poison in the food, they’re probably active within the inner compound. Once we catch such a person, we absolutely cannot show them any mercy!” Ling Taian thought of how someone had repeatedly reached into his own household, and he could not suppress his fury.
“In that case, I’ll instruct the steward matron to investigate the people in the kitchen. We can’t let a single suspicious person slip through the net.” As Madam Liu spoke, she rose and ordered the steward matron to investigate.
“Father, we’ll take our leave for now as well. Please get some rest.” Ling Jiayue and Ling Jiaxuan withdrew after saying this.
Ling Taian sat quietly on the bed, thinking that ever since Ling Jiayue had returned, one calamity after another had followed. The Third Prince and Ling Jiayue had both once been obedient children—how had they ended up like this?
The siblings walked side by side along the path. Ling Jiaxuan said, “Little sister, I truly wish you could live in peace and safety. Unfortunately, ever since you returned, trouble has followed you without end. If only we’d known, we should have refused no matter what when His Majesty arranged your marriage. Then the Ling Residence wouldn’t have had to suffer repeated plots and attacks from others.”
“It’s all right, Older Brother. Once we find the mole, everything will be fine,” Ling Jiayue comforted him.
The siblings continued walking in silence, their minds filled with countless thoughts.
“Older Brother, I’m going to Mother’s place to see how the steward matron’s investigation is going. You should return to your courtyard first,” Ling Jiayue said.
“That’s fine. I’m not in a convenient position to interfere in matters of the inner compound. Go ahead. I’ll investigate whether any of the young male servants in our inner compound have been behaving dishonestly,” Ling Jiaxuan said.
The siblings went off to attend to their respective tasks.
When Ling Jiayue arrived at Madam Liu’s courtyard, the steward matron was reporting the results of her investigation into the kitchen staff.
“Madam, this is the list of everyone in the kitchen. Please look it over.” The steward matron respectfully handed the list to Madam Liu.
Just as Madam Liu took the list, Ling Jiayue happened to enter. Madam Liu immediately said, “Yue’er, come help me look this over. I’ve just examined the list and found nothing unusual. You take a look as well.”
Ling Jiayue accepted the list from Madam Liu and began examining it carefully. Before long, she noticed something unusual.
“Mother, there’s a maid in the kitchen who looks terribly familiar to me,” Ling Jiayue said.
“Which maid?” Madam Liu asked.
“Lingxin,” Ling Jiayue replied.
“Lingxin?”
“Yes, Lingxin. She’s one of the maids whose name begins with ‘Ling,’ which clearly means she was once a personal senior maid serving one of the young ladies of the residence, like Lingxue and Lingzhu at my side. But if her name is Lingxin, why is she working in the kitchen?” Ling Jiayue asked, puzzled.
“Replying to Miss Ling, Lingxin was originally one of Ling Ziqi’s maids. Now that Ling Ziqi has become Madam Ru to the Third Prince, Lingxin was sent to work in the kitchen,” the steward matron explained.
“I see. Has Lingxin been behaving herself in the kitchen lately? Has she been in contact with anyone?” Ling Jiayue asked.
“Yue’er, do you suspect Lingxin?” Madam Liu asked.
“Yes, Mother. Lingxin was Ling Ziqi’s personal senior maid. She’s just like Lingxue and Lingzhu at my side, so their bond is naturally different from ordinary master-and-servant ties. There’s no guarantee that Lingxin won’t take Ling Ziqi’s side.” Ling Jiayue clenched the list in her hand.
“That makes sense, Yue’er. Your suspicions are reasonable,” Madam Liu said.
“Steward matron, from this moment on, keep a close watch on Lingxin. I suspect she’s connected to the poison in Father’s body. But remember—don’t alert her,” Ling Jiayue ordered.
“Yes, Miss.” The steward matron accepted the order.
“Mother, I still need to go to Older Brother’s place and discuss the inner compound’s defenses with him.” Ling Jiayue said this and prepared to take her leave.
“Go, good child. Don’t tire yourself out.”
After leaving Madam Liu’s courtyard, Ling Jiayue walked along with Lingxue and Lingzhu. The three of them proceeded quietly down the path.
“Miss, is Lingxin really connected to Master’s poisoning?” Lingzhu had a lively personality and could not help asking.
“Lingzhu, Lingzhu, if I asked you to do something for me, would you go and do it?” Ling Jiayue answered with a question.
“Of course. We would gladly go through fire and water for you, Miss,” Lingxue and Lingzhu replied in unison.
“Exactly. Lingxin and Ling Ziqi spent even more time together than we did as master and servants, so Lingxin must favor Ling Ziqi. Still, this is good in its own way. At least now we know whom to suspect. That’s better than knowing nothing at all.” Ling Jiayue spoke as they walked.
As they talked, the three of them arrived at Ling Jiaxuan’s courtyard. Bamboo grew everywhere in the courtyard, giving it an elegant, unrestrained air. Ling Jiayue suddenly remembered Ling Jiaxuan once declaring with great conviction, “A man can eat without meat, but he cannot live without bamboo. Eating no meat makes a man thin; living without bamboo makes him vulgar.”
Ling Jiayue shook her head, finding it amusing. Once inside the courtyard, she called out loudly, “Older Brother, are you there?”
When Ling Jiaxuan heard that his little sister had arrived, he hurriedly rose to greet her. He had just changed into his usual white home clothes. His handsome, refined appearance was already striking, and with the bright smile he wore as he came out to welcome his sister, he looked even more dashing.
Lingzhu and Lingxue were both young women, and upon seeing Ling Jiaxuan dressed like that, they blushed.
Ling Jiayue teased him, “Older Brother, you’re probably the most outstanding-looking man in our residence. When you go out in the future, will you come home carrying embroidered purses from all the young ladies? Then Mother won’t have to worry about arranging your marriage anymore.”
When Lingxue and Lingzhu heard Ling Jiaxuan being teased, they covered their mouths and laughed. Ling Jiaxuan, however, pretended to be angry and said, “How heartless of you, little girl, to make fun of me like that.”
“All right, Older Brother, let’s stop fooling around. I came to see you because of Father. Let’s go inside and talk.” Ling Jiayue rarely put on such a serious expression.
“Fine, let’s go inside and talk.” Ling Jiaxuan led Ling Jiayue—
Ling Jiayue entered the room and, apparently chilled by the cold outside, shivered when a wave of warmth washed over her. Seeing this, Ling Jiaxuan ordered, “Qingfeng, bring in several more braziers.”
As he spoke, Ling Jiaxuan stuffed a hand warmer into Ling Jiayue’s hands and told her to hold it. He continued muttering, “You’re already this grown, so how can you not know when you’re cold or hot? Your health clearly isn’t very good, yet you went out without even carrying a hand warmer. Are you trying to get sick?”
Ling Jiayue drew the hand warmer closer and said coquettishly, “I’m not that fragile. I knew your room would be warm, so I deliberately didn’t bring a hand warmer. If I really do get sick, that would be perfect—I could make you worry about me for once.”
Ling Jiaxuan shook his head with a smile. Knowing he could never win an argument with Ling Jiayue, he said no more.
